Johnathan Sutkowski
June 7th, 1973 - December 13th, 2021
Obituary John "Monkey" Sutkowski 48, died December 13, 2021 at Longmont United Hospital after struggling with complications from Covid-19. He was born June 7, 1973 in Norwich, CT, son of Cynthia Way (Edmondson) and Steven Sutkowski. John practiced as an LPN for a few years in Illinois and then moved to Colorado with a friend to start a business. He also worked in traffic control and in production at Royal Crest Dairy (longmont) and Celestial Seasoning (gunbarrel). John loved the Renaissance Festival, D and D, Magic the Gathering, video games, comics, and fantasy books. He also wanted to learn how to make jewelry and chain mail. John faced most situations with humor. He was intelligent and compassionate. John always found ways to make others smile. He was hardworking, fun-loving, and loyal to a fault. John was preceded in death by his father Steven Sutkowski. He is survived by his mother Cynthia Edmondson, his stepmother Carol Sutkowski, his stepfather Bob Edmondson, two sisters Sara and Amy Edmondson, step sister Darlene, two brothers Jeremy and Bobby Brooks, his wife Keary Sutkowski, and his daughter Keira Waller. Dates for a memorial have not been determined, but will be communicated with friends and family when scheduled.
